Scotland 0 England 20
ENGLAND put their RBS 6 Nations campaign back on track with a comprehensive victory over Scotland.
Luther Burrell and Mike Brown scored a try apiece while Owen Farrell booted a penalty and Danny Care slotted a snap drop goal.
But the Murrayfield pitch had its say as both Farrell and Greig Laidlaw missed two penalties each.
England entered the Murrayfield clash needing a win to keep alive their Championship hopes after a 26-24 defeat to France in Paris last week.
Billy Twelvetrees and Jonny May both started for England while Ben Morgan produced another cameo performance from the bench in the 70th minute, replacing Billy Vunipola.
The Six Nations takes a week-long break now before England take on Ireland in Round Three
